The Impact of Sugary Foods on Tooth Decay



Sugar's impact on dental caries is a significant worry. When you consume sugary foods and beverages, the microorganisms in your mouth eat the sugars and produce acids that attack the tooth enamel. This acid disintegration can bring about dental caries and tooth decay with time. Regularly delighting in sugary treats enhances the danger of establishing oral problems, especially without correct oral health.

Limiting your consumption of sweet foods and drinks is important for preserving healthy and balanced teeth and gums. Go with healthier choices like vegetables and fruits, which not only satisfy your pleasant food cravings however also offer essential nutrients for oral health and wellness. Bear in mind, decreasing your sugar usage is crucial to stop dental cavity and maintaining your lovely smile.

Nutrient-Rich Foods for Solid Enamel



Boost your oral health and wellness by integrating nutrient-rich foods into your daily regimen. These foods can help strengthen your enamel and advertise solid teeth. Right here are three necessary foods that can add to maintaining healthy and balanced enamel:



1. Milk items: Milk, cheese, and yogurt are excellent resources of calcium. Calcium is essential for strong teeth as it assists restore enamel and enhance the jawbone. This, consequently, decreases the danger of tooth decay.

2. Leafy environment-friendly vegetables: Spinach, kale, and broccoli are loaded with important minerals and vitamins like vitamin C and calcium. These nutrients are beneficial for gum tissue health and protect against periodontal condition.

3. Lean proteins: Hen, fish, and eggs are rich in phosphorus, an additional vital nutrient for keeping enamel toughness. Phosphorus, along with calcium, aids remineralize and repair damaged enamel.

By consisting of these nutrient-rich foods in your diet, you can provide your teeth with the required building blocks for strong enamel and total oral health and wellness.
